About Agriculture Law in Ocala, United States

Agriculture is a significant aspect of the economy in Ocala, United States, with many farms and agricultural businesses thriving in the region. Agriculture law governs the various legal issues that can arise in this industry, from land use and zoning regulations to environmental compliance and labor issues.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

You may need a lawyer for various reasons related to agriculture, such as drafting contracts for land leases, resolving disputes with neighboring properties, navigating regulatory requirements, or seeking compensation for damages caused by agricultural activities.

Local Laws Overview

In Ocala, United States, local laws related to agriculture may include zoning ordinances that dictate where agricultural activities can take place, water usage regulations, environmental protection laws, and tax incentives for agricultural businesses. It is essential to understand these laws to ensure compliance and avoid legal issues.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I start an agricultural business in Ocala, United States?

A: Yes, you can start an agricultural business in Ocala, but you may need to obtain permits and comply with zoning regulations.

Q: Do I need a lawyer to draft a farm lease?

A: It is recommended to have a lawyer draft a farm lease to ensure that all parties' rights and responsibilities are clearly outlined.

Q: What environmental regulations apply to agriculture in Ocala?

A: There are various environmental regulations that agricultural businesses in Ocala must comply with, such as waste disposal laws and water quality standards.

Q: What should I do if my neighbor's agriculture activities are causing problems for my property?

A: You may need to consult with a lawyer to address issues with neighboring properties, such as boundary disputes or nuisance claims.
